## Deployment: Timezone Handling

Report exports in Quillbird always render timestamps in the tenant's configured zone, not UTC. The scheduler, however, fires on UTC boundaries. If a tenant's zone is unset, exports fall back to the cluster default and will silently shift by the offset. Do not hand-edit zone data on the pods; it ships with the base image. Set the values below in the deploy manifest before the first rollout.

deployment values, fahap-hahaf:
[casdor]
port = 9200
region = south-2
host = casdor.qirvanworks.corp
timeout_ms = 3000
retries = 4

**Q: Why are Lanternfall handlers slow on the first request after a quiet period?**

A: This is a cold start. When a handler has been idle for more than ten minutes, the Lanternfall scheduler reclaims its worker, so the next invocation must pull the bundle, initialize the runtime, and warm connection pools. Expect 2–4 seconds of added latency. If you see cold starts on a hot path, enable the pre-warm flag in the service manifest or raise the idle timeout. If pre-warming does not resolve it, escalate to the platform team at the address below.

escalation mailbox, bafog-fafog: ulador@paliqlabs.internal

Drift on GiftStub, the donation-receipt mailer. Prod picked up a hotfix last Thursday; staging never got it. Retry intervals and template cache settings now differ, so receipt batches behave differently per environment. Blocking the Friday release until reconciled. Current prod values for comparison are listed below.

service settings:
[istael]
port = 5000
region = north-1
host = istael.qirvancorp.internal
timeout_ms = 500
retries = 6

**Ticket TS-418: Signature check failing on timetable solver deploy**

The ClassWeave solver build fails verification on the Renfell staging cluster since Tuesday. Root cause: the pipeline still references the credential retired during last week's rotation. Fix is to update the verifier config before Thursday's release. For the eng sync record, the replacement signing key is below.

deploy key for kajof-fajop: bky6_gDHw9Q